This enigmatic land, known as South England, has remained isolated from the rest of England since the 1500s, with its own unique culture and history. Just south lies New France, populated by descendants of 16th Century French settlers. Based on the journals of one of the officers, the narrative paints a vivid picture of a large island resembling a squat British Isles, where the ruling monarchy, descended from the Plantagenets, is facing its own struggles. The social and political landscape echoes the satirical tones of Mark Twains A Connecticut Yankee in King Arthurs Court, rife with romance and discord that ultimately lead to inevitable disaster.
